Convection (in the outer core) produces Earth's magnetic field, and (in the mantle) makes solid rocks flow, which is important for the plate tectonics.

Air is a fluid and behaves in ways we expect of other fluids and temperature changes can cause density changes in water.

Why are convection heaters called convection heaters?

* In one of two major types of heat convection, the heat is carried passively by a fluid motion which would occur anyway without the heating process. This heat transfer process is often termed "forced convection" or occasionally "heat advection." * In the other major type of heat convection, heating itself may cause the fluid motion (via expansion and buoyancy force), while at the same time also causing heat to be transported by this bulk motion of the fluid. This process is called natural convection, or "free convection". In the latter case, the problem of heat transport (and related transport of other substances in the fluid due to it) is generally more complicated. Both forcedand natural types of heat convection may occur together (in that case being termed mixed convection).
